Description Guidelines with specific action plans to become a dual-language video remote interpreter (VRI). This webinar provides basic knowledge, understanding and guided practice to start developing your talents as a bilingual remote video interpreter or to consolidate your understanding and abilities if you are a dialogue VRI already. You will learn specifics about the profession and the environment in which it is practiced, the profile and the skills needed. Special attention is given to achieving the highest level of professionalism in the rendering of dialogue VRI services. Actual practice is encouraged in different aspects such as video etiquette, performing before the camera; customer service and technical troubleshooting. Language: This well designed and interesting workspace is language-neutral with content delivered in English and appropriate for any language pair. Note: This is Level 2 of a 2-part bundle.
